Abstract
The phase behaviour of lateral substituted side group copolymethacryla tes was investigated. With structural changes it is possible to influe nce the phase behaviour of the polymers. The lateral substituents have a stronger influence in side group polymers then in low molecular sys tems because of the coupling of the mesogens via the main chain. Accor ding to simulations, the possibility of rotational motions of the side groups around their long axis is hampered by a lateral substitution. With the described structural changes in the mesogen we have synthesiz ed side group copolymethacrylates on the border between the liquid cry stalline and the amorphous state. In some further papers we will discu ss the consequences of a lateral substitution in the mesogen in the de scribed materials for the dielectrical and photochemical behaviour.
